Encoding and processing into web-friendly formats
13 avril 2011, parMediaSPIP automatically converts uploaded files to internet-compatible formats.
Video files are encoded in MP4, Ogv and WebM (supported by HTML5) and MP4 (supported by Flash).
Audio files are encoded in MP3 and Ogg (supported by HTML5) and MP3 (supported by Flash).
Where possible, text is analyzed in order to retrieve the data needed for search engine detection, and then exported as a series of image files.

Shaking/trembling in video slideshow generated by frames from an image
18 mai 2017, par razielI have a PHP program which is used to generate a video slideshow from the series of images. Basically, I just need to smoothly ‘move’ from one image area to the another one according to the specified top/left coordinates and width/height area of the image. In order to do smooth movement, I use easing functions during the coordinates calculations for the each of video frame. I make an jpeg image frame based on these calculations using PHP’s Imagick library, then I combine all the generated frames into a single video using ffmpeg command.
